BCAAs hit the market most commonly in a 2:1:1 ratio of leucine to isoleucine and valine, mirroring the natural ratio found in human muscle. This formulation has the backing of most studies and fits well with the way muscles process these amino acids during exercise and recovery. However, you’ll find variation—manufacturers in certain regions offer 4:1:1 or even 8:1:1 ratios. The higher leucine content is often marketed to vegetarians or athletes who want a sharper trigger on muscle protein synthesis.
Beyond ratios, form factors differ widely. Powders dominate because they mix easily with shakes and fluids, but capsules and ready-to-drink beverages carve out growing shares of the market. Taste also plays a role in adoption; flavor profiles range from unflavored for mixing flexibility to fruit punch and citrus blends tailored to regional palates.

Formulation impacts how fast and efficient the supplement triggers muscle repair and synthesis after a tough session, with leucine playing the lead role in activating the mTOR pathway. Some countries emphasize leucine-heavy blends thinking it ups the ante on results, but science so far doesn’t back ratios much beyond 2:1:1 for the average athlete. Serving sizes hover between 4 and 20 grams daily depending on the athlete’s program and product concentration.

First off, the big regulators worldwide have weighed in with guidelines based on decades of data. Adverse events related to BCAAs are rare, especially when you stick to recommended doses. Still, like any supplement, overdoing it may lead to issues, particularly for folks with existing kidney or liver problems.
In the US, the FDA treats BCAAs as dietary supplements. That means they don’t require pre-market approval but have to follow good manufacturing practices and accurate labeling. There’s no magic number set in stone by the FDA, but generally, daily intake is capped around 20 grams to stay safe.
Labels must include warnings for people with medical conditions and clearly state that these products aren’t intended to diagnose, treat, or cure diseases, which is standard language in this space. You won’t find BCAAs classified as drugs here, so consumers get the flexibility—but also the responsibility—to use them wisely.
Cross over to the EU, and BCAAs fall under food supplements with a nod from EFSA (European Food Safety Authority). They don’t classify them as novel foods or medicines, but there’s more variation country-to-country on max dosages.
Some countries recommend a maximum daily intake around 15 to 35 grams, but strict monitoring of contaminants and purity is emphasized. EFSA has evaluated data on safety, particularly focusing on leucine load and any long-term impacts. Labels follow strict regulations about health claims—no exaggerated promises allowed.
Up north, Health Canada treats BCAAs as natural health products, placing them under a framework closer to regulated supplements. Maximum recommended daily doses can go up to 30 grams, with requirements for product licensing and safety data submissions.
Packaging must include clear dosage instructions, active ingredient lists, and appropriate warnings. It's a spot where consumers can expect consistent quality due to regulatory oversight, reducing the risk of dodgy products.
Outside these major markets, regulatory stances vary widely. Some countries classify BCAA supplements as nutraceuticals with minimal rules, while others have tighter controls. The takeaway? Know your local laws before stocking up, especially if you’re buying imported products.

What about reports of side effects? Most users breeze through BCAA supplementation without a hitch. The occasional complaints involve mild stomach issues or nausea, often linked to taking high doses on an empty stomach.
Serious adverse events are seldom and usually appear in people with pre-existing health conditions who exceed recommended doses. There’s no hard evidence that standard BCAA supplements harm healthy athletes, but like anything else, keep tabs on how your body reacts.

Here’s the kicker: Intellectual property for supplements isn’t like locking down a winning hand in Vegas. In the US, patents are rare and tough to uphold for ingredients that have been around the block.
Europe and Asia shake out differently, with some countries offering stronger protection on formulations or novel delivery methods. This means innovation sometimes rolls out faster in specific regions.
